Window Screen Repair: A Comprehensive Guide
Window screens play an important function in maintaining a comfy indoor environment while allowing fresh air to stream into homes. They stay out insects and particles, helping to enhance indoor air quality and presence. Regrettably, over time, screens can establish holes, tears, or other damage from direct exposure to aspects or unexpected accidents. This short article provides a helpful expedition of window screen repair, detailing the required tools, techniques, and beneficial tips for both DIY lovers and those thinking about professional services.
Understanding Window Screens
Before diving into repair methods, it is necessary to understand the different kinds of Window Glass Repair screens readily available:

- Fiberglass Screens: These are lightweight and resist rust, making them a popular choice. They are simple to stream and typically been available in different colors.
- Aluminum Screens: Tough and lasting, aluminum screens are more robust and resistant to damage. Nevertheless, they can be prone to rust.
- Solar Screens: Designed to obstruct hazardous UV rays and excess heat, solar screens can assist enhance energy performance in homes.
- Family pet Screens: Made of tougher materials, animal screens are ideal for homes with animals, as they withstand scratches and strong effects.
Understanding the kind of screen you have will significantly affect the repair approach you take.
Typical Types of Damage
The initial step in repairing window screens is determining the type of damage. Typical types consist of:
- Holes and Tears: Caused by weather wear or physical effect, these can be little leaks or bigger rips.
- Rusted Frames: Frames, specifically those made from aluminum, can develop rust, compromising their integrity.
- Weathered Fabric: Over time, the screen material can fade or deteriorate due to UV direct exposure.

Do It Yourself Window Screen Repair Techniques
1. Fixing Small Holes and Tears
Little holes or tears can quickly be repaired without replacing the whole screen. Here's how:
- Clean the Area: Start by cleaning up the location around the hole or tear to make sure correct adhesion.
- Utilize a Patch: Cut a piece of screen product somewhat bigger than the hole. If you do not have replacement material, a piece of clear tape can work in a pinch.
- Use the Patch: Securely place the spot over the damage and utilize adhesive or staples to protect it in location.
2. Changing the Entire Screen
If the damage is extensive, it might be more effective to replace the whole screen. Follow these actions:
- Remove the Frame: Use a flathead screwdriver to remove any screws holding the screen frame in place.
- Eliminate Old Screen Material: Take off the old screen material from the frame, together with the old spline.
- Cut New Screen Material: Lay the brand-new screen product over the frame, leaving about an inch of extra material around the edges.
- Secure the New Screen: Place the screen over the frame, securing it utilizing the spline, and cut the excess material with your utility knife.
- Reinstall Frame: Place the frame back into the Trusted Window Doctor opening and secure it with screws.
3. Fixing Rusted Frames
Rusted frames can often be salvaged instead of being entirely replaced:
- Remove Rust: Use sandpaper or a rust remover to remove the rust from the frame.
- Clean the Frame: Thoroughly tidy the area before using any protective coating.
- Apply Primer and Paint: Once the rust is gotten rid of, it is a good idea to use a rust-inhibiting primer and repaint to avoid future rust.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: Can I utilize routine fabric for window screen repair?
A1: It is recommended to use customized screen materials as they are developed to stand up to climate condition and are more long lasting than routine fabric.
Q2: How can I prevent my window screens from getting harmed?
A2: Regular maintenance and inspection can assist. It's suggested to clean your screens typically and replace any damaged product without delay.
Q3: How typically should I replace window screens?
A3: Custom Window Doctor screens can last numerous years with proper care. Nevertheless, after dealing with substantial wear or damage, especially in areas exposed to harsh weather, replacements ought to be thought about.
Q4: Is it possible to repair a screen with screens that have an animal damage?
A4: Yes, utilizing family pet screen product designed to hold up against harder wear can be a practical service for pet-stressed screens.
